Title
Principle and application of flexibly adjustable dynamic resource for VAr compensation

Abstract
In this paper, a sort of power system VAr generator mainly based on GTO (gate turn-off thyristor) is described. The principle and the characteristics are analysed. The prototype of the device is realized in the laboratory. The adjustment is flexible and fast as expected
